In 1995, the life expectancy of males in a certain country was 70.1 years. In 1999, it was 73.6 years. Let E represent the number of years since 1995.

The linear function E(t) that fits the data is E(t) =_____ t +______.(Round to the nearest tenth)
Use the function to predict the life expectancy of males in 2004.
E(9) =_____.(Round to the nearest tenth)

Two given points are

for year 1995, P1(0,70.1) and
for year 1999, P2(4,73.6)
The linear function that passes through these two points is given by:
(y-y1)/(y2-y1)=(x-x1)/(x2-x1)

Substitute x1=0,y1=70.1, x2=4,y2=73.6, solve for y in terms of x.
